Compete for Cure raises nearly $3000

Publication details

"Compete for Cure raises nearly $3000" was published on September 1, 2004 in Worthington News (SNP), page 8.
Pamela Willis is the author.

Subjects

It covers the topics community service, cancer and Susan G. Komen Race for the Cure.
It covers the city Worthington.

Full text

Available at Worthington Libraries on microfilm roll number 1288649831. Contact library staff for more information.
